Phase transition at low ̄uences in laser desorption of organic solids: a molecular dynamics study

Molecular dynamics of a short pulse laser irradiation of a molecular crystal are performed to investigate the dependence of the mechanism of ejection on laser ̄uence. We ®nd that at low laser ̄uences molecules are desorbed from a thin surface layer of solid sample. An increase in the laser ̄uence leads to the melting of the surface region and desorption occurs from an overheated melted state. An additional increase of the ̄uence leads to the ablation when the laser-induced pressure and phase explosion of the overheated liquid drives a collective ejection of a signi®cant volume of irradiated material.
